Take a look at the proposal, Chipp. It's to deprecate "delete stack" and replace it with two new commands - one to delete a substack from its stack file, and the other to remove a main stack from memory. The functionality will still be there - just split into two commands, to match the two things delete stack does.

Right, so long as deprecation means "it still functions, we just recommend not using it any more", then that should be fine. Like Chipp, I have that function everywhere in my stacks.

Though, given transcript's immense dictionary, it doesn't look like much ever actually gets removed, just updated with new preferred syntax... which for the most part, is a good thing. Certainly in terms of backward compatibility if not "crispness." ;-)
